#8b3bc4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b3bc4 is composed of 54.5% red, 23.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 50%. #8b3bc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#170089.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#8b3bc4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b3bc4 has RGB values of R:139, G:59,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 9124804.

Shades and Tints of #8b3bc4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b050f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b3bc4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817689 is the less saturated color, while #9500ff is the most saturated one.
